June 24th Letter from the Pastor

Shared by ESPC

Letter to Congregation 06-24-2020

June 24, 2020

Dear Sisters and Brothers in Christ,

I write to you today having just finished a phone call sharing with a Synod staff all the wonderful things this church has done in these past months to address the needs of our community. I love to share how ESPC has been wonderful at following our calling by living into the mission to be the hands and voice of God in our community. The wonderful Christian song 10,000 Reasons by Matt Redman reminds me I have many reasons to praise the Lord. I praise the Lord for all the work God has done and continues to do through you. Prior to pandemic, a good chunk of ministry to the community occurred inside our building. This pandemic has opened up new ways of reaching our community while also still being available to continue the ministries that were bringing over 1000 people through our doors weekly. I can’t wait to have the opportunity to praise God for all the new ways we will continue to live into our mission and bring Christ’s love to those around us.

I also feel blessed that we have a building that makes in person worship possible! (albeit in a new and different way) Because of past faithful members and great leaders, both past and present, we will be continuing with our phase 1 in person worship this Sunday. A letter was sent with guidelines as to what that entails, and I would encourage you to review those guidelines. Our continued goal is to have as many people as possible feel welcome to worship with us which is why we are offering worship in many different ways including the occasional outdoor service. For those of you who feel more comfortable being at home we will continue to live stream services. Please do not feel obligated to come to in-person worship and if you have any symptoms of illness please worship from home. I look forward to rejoicing with all of you both in the church and beyond the church walls.
